DocuSign Envelope ID: D1 D7B029-ODBD-4276-9A2E-BOA56F6E0688 <br />RESOLUTION NO. 2024-05 BY: Baker, Bullock, Kepple, Marx, <br />Shachner, Strebig <br />A RESOLUTION to take effect immediately provided it receives the affirmative vote of <br />at least two thirds of the members of Council, or otherwise to take effect and be in force at the <br />earliest period allowed by law, authorizing the Mayor to enter into an agreement with the <br />Westshore Council of Governments for the purchase of a Bearcat armored vehicle for use by the <br />member communities with Lakewood's allocated share of the cost being $104,316. <br />WHEREAS, the Westshore Council of Governments (WCOG) is in need of an armored <br />vehicle for law enforcement purposes for use by the member communities; and <br />WHEREAS, the total cost of the vehicle is estimated to be $3 82,000, which cost will be <br />allocated among the member communities pursuant to the WCOG Agreement; and <br />WHEREAS, as set forth in Section 2.12 of the Third Amended Charter of the City of <br />Lakewood, this Council by a vote of at least two thirds of its members determines that this <br />resolution is an emergency measure and that it shall take effect immediately, and that it is <br />necessary for the immediate preservation of the public property, health, and safety and to provide <br />for the usual daily operation of municipal departments, in that this agreement is necessary for <br />WCOG to proceed with the purchase of this vehicle before the quote expires on March 22, 2024 <br />for the benefit of the member communities; now, therefore, <br />BE IT RESOLVED BY THE CITY OF LAKEWOOD, OHIO: <br />Section 1. That the Mayor be and is hereby authorized to enter into an agreement with the <br />Westshore Council of Governments (WCOG) for the purchase of a Bearcat armored vehicle in <br />the amount of $104,306, which represents Lakewood's allocated share of the total purchase price <br />of $380,000. <br />Section 2. It is found and determined that all formal actions of this Council concerning <br />and relating to the passage of this resolution were adopted in an open meeting of this Council, <br />and that all such deliberations of this Council and of any of its committees that resulted in such <br />formal action were in meetings open to the public in compliance with all legal requirements. <br />Section 3. This resolution is hereby declared to be an emergency measure necessary for <br />the immediate preservation of the public peace, property, health, safety and welfare in the City <br />and for the usual daily operation of the City for the reasons set forth and defined in the preamble <br />to this resolution, and provided it receives the affirmative vote of at least two thirds of the <br />members of Council, this resolution shall take effect and be in force immediately upon its <br />
